Using a computer Connecting the camera to a computer Selecting the appropriate USB connection method Selects the USB connection method when this product is connected to a computer, etc. MENU  (Setup)  [USB Connection]  desired setting. Auto: Establishes a Mass Storage or MTP connection automatically, depending on the computer or other USB devices to be connected. Windows 7, Windows 8.1, or Windows 10 computers are connected in MTP, and their unique functions are enabled for use. Mass Storage: Establishes a Mass Storage connection between this product, a computer, and other USB devices. MTP: Establishes an MTP connection between this product, a computer, and other USB devices. Windows 7, Windows 8.1, or Windows 10 computers are connected in MTP, and their unique functions are enabled for use. ••The memory card in memory card slot 1 is the connection target. PC Remote: Uses "Remote Camera Control" (page 204) to control this product from the computer, including such functions as shooting and storing images on the computer. Note ••It may take some time to make the connection between this product and a computer when [USB Connection] is set to [Auto]. GB 200
